5.0 Installation / Setup 

5.1 Pump Requirements 

Ensure  that  the  hydraulic  pump  to  be  used  is  suitable  for  the  cylinder/s  to  which  it  will  connect.  For  a  
single-acting cylinder (one pressure coupling connection), a single-acting hydraulic pump fitted with either 
a 2-way or 3-way valve and a single, correctly rated hose, must be used. 

5.2 Hydraulic Connections 

Connect  the  hydraulic  hose/s  between  the  cylinder/s  and  the  pump,  ensuring  that  the  coupler/s  are  

fully

 

hand-tightened ONLY

. To do so: [1] Press the male coupler into the female coupler (1), [2] then turn 

the threaded-collar clockwise (by hand) until the threads are fully engaged. 

NEVER

  use  wrenches  in  an  attempt  to  connect  the  coupling/s.  Incorrectly  connected 

coupling/s are one of the most common causes of faulty operation. 

IMPORTANT:

 Make sure that all coupler threads are fully engaged. (

See figure 5.2, panel 3
